Output 8459875e9ea29ac5505a15d5627f99e481b99f2228e9ed1262b76341d43d5c46:7

value
368065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b55627116156123a89ced7e113dc80a6054899 OP_EQUAL
address
3FXBBza1UVjjf9B8oWanei3kcQJPFh9jyR
transaction
8459875e9ea29ac5505a15d5627f99e481b99f2228e9ed1262b76341d43d5c46
spent
true